A level less than 22 milliequivalents per liter (mEq/L) can indicate that acidosis is present.\n \n Adrenal glands: To help the kidneys eliminate an acid load, the adrenal glands secrete a hormone called aldosterone.\n \n\nBecause the adrenal glands secrete aldosterone in response to acidosis, acidosis increases stress on the adrenal glands. In response to an acid load, the body produces buffers in your cells, in the bloodstream, and in your bones.\nExamples of buffers in the bone include minerals such as calcium and magnesium.
